Industry/Case Study:Building Maintenance for International Insurance Company

An International Insurance Company bought a division in Fort Wayne, Indiana. The operations are run from a leased facility containing over 325,000 square feet. This facility has a combination of chillers, boilers, roof-top HVAC equipment, and a newer Annex building which uses a geothermal system. All maintenance and repairs to the facility were the responsibility of the Insurance Company (the Tenant). Maintenance Management was hired to maintain the facilities, and we placed four full-time employees on-site to handle the operations.

Our duties included heating and air-conditioning maintenance/ repairs, electrical maintenance and routine daily maintenance of the facilities. In addition we provided services directly to the Insurance Company for moving telephone extensions and setting up their audio and video conferencing as required. We work with their Property Management department on a daily basis to handle, oversee or inspect building projects.
